fastdo  0.6.8
winux::FileSysError类 参考

文件系统错误类 更多...

#include <filesys.hpp>

类 winux::FileSysError 继承关系图:
winux::FileSysError 的协作图:

Public 类型

enum  {
  fseNone, fseNotImplemented, fseNotFound, fsePermissionDenied,
  fseInvalidArgument
}
 

Public 成员函数

 FileSysError (int errType, AnsiString const &s) throw ()
 
- Public 成员函数 继承自 winux::Error
 Error () throw ()
 
 Error (int errType, AnsiString const &errStr) throw ()
 
virtual ~Error () throw ()
 
virtual int getErrType () const throw ()
 
virtual char const * what () const throw ()
 

详细描述

文件系统错误类

在文件 filesys.hpp160 行定义.

成员枚举类型说明

anonymous enum
枚举值
fseNone 

没有错误

fseNotImplemented 

方法未实现

fseNotFound 

文件系统错误:文件或目录不存在

fsePermissionDenied 

文件系统错误:无权限拒绝访问

fseInvalidArgument 

文件系统错误:无效参数

在文件 filesys.hpp163 行定义.

构造及析构函数说明

winux::FileSysError::FileSysError ( int  errType,
AnsiString const &  s 
)
throw (
)
inline

在文件 filesys.hpp171 行定义.


该类的文档由以下文件生成: